Abstract
This study utilizes a new mobile pilot plant to capture CO2
from real biogas with 30 wt% monoethanolamine (MEA). The pilot plant is
described in detail and validated by data reconciliation showing that
the pilot plant produces reliable steady state data. It is demonstrated
that the pilot plant can upgrade 32 kg biogas per hour by capturing
20 kg CO2 per hour. Further, the pilot plant can achieve below 2.5 mol% CO2 in the methane product at a specific reboiler duty of 3.74 GJ per ton of CO2.
The absorber column was found to be operated close to pinch conditions
as temperatures reached above 90 °C giving a potential for process
optimization and heat integration.
